On February 25, 2026, at approximately 4:10 PM, Sergeant Prink with the Rochester Police Department saw a vehicle with no front license plate at the intersection of 2nd Street Southwest and Highway 52. The vehicle was a 2010 Chrysler Sebring and therefore not subject to any exceptions to the requirement that the vehicle have both a front and a rear license plate. Sergeant Prink conducted a traffic stop and made contact with the driver, JONTRELL JOSIAH OVERTON-SMITH, [DOB REDACTED], who admitted his driver’s license was revoked.
Overton-Smith stated the vehicle belonged to someone else, and he did not know if the vehicle had valid insurance. Sergeant Prink confirmed Overton-Smith’s driving status to be canceled inimical to public safety and placed him under arrest. During a search incident to arrest, Sergeant Prink located tinfoil containing residue as well as a small amount of a suspected controlled substance in Overton-Smith’s pocket. The substance later tested presumptive positive for fentanyl and weighed.2 grams. Overton-Smith has previously been convicted of a violation of Minnesota Statute 152.025. Officer Garcia and Officer Roussell with the Rochester Police Department responded to assist Sergeant Prink.
Officer Roussell observed a glass pipe inside the vehicle in plain view, and Officer Garcia observed tin foil that appeared to be similar to the tin foil located on Overton-Smith’s person. Based upon these observations, officers searched the vehicle. Officer Garcia located a black box on the front passenger seat. Inside the box was a small black bag, and inside that bag were three clear plastic baggies containing what appeared to be a controlled substance. The substance later tested presumptive positive for methamphetamine and weighed 18.3 grams without packaging.
